GNU bug report logs - #11718
24.1.50; `all-completions' returns results with wrong case

Previous Next

Package: emacs;

Reported by: michael_heerdegen <at> web.de

Date: Fri, 15 Jun 2012 19:00:02 UTC

Severity: normal

Tags: fixed

Found in versions 24.1.50, 24.3

Fixed in version 24.4

Done: npostavs <at> users.sourceforge.net

Bug is archived. No further changes may be made.

Full log


Message #48 received at control <at> debbugs.gnu.org (full text, mbox):

From: npostavs <at> users.sourceforge.net
To: Michael Heerdegen <michael_heerdegen <at> web.de>
Cc: 11718 <at> debbugs.gnu.org
Subject: Re: bug#11718: 24.1.50;
 `all-completions' returns results with wrong case
Date: Fri, 08 Jul 2016 19:17:38 -0400
found 11718 24.3
tags 11718 fixed
close 11718 24.4
quit

Michael Heerdegen <michael_heerdegen <at> web.de> writes:

> Hello,
>
> I use emacs-snapshot on Debian Linux ("GNU Emacs 24.1.50.1
> (i486-pc-linux-gnu, GTK+ Version 3.4.2)\n of 2012-06-14 on zelenka,
> modified by Debian").
>
> I have a directory "~/Trash".  If I eval
>
>    (let ((completion-ignore-case t))
>      (all-completions "~/tra" 'read-file-name-internal 
>                       'file-exists-p nil))
>
> in emacs -Q, I get
>
>   (#("trash/" 0 3 (face completions-common-part)))
>
> Note the wrong lower case of the result.  In Emacs 23, however, I get
>
>   ("Trash/")

Emacs 24.3 gives (#("trash/" 0 3 (face completions-common-part)))
Emacs 24.4 gives (#("Trash/" 0 3 (face completions-common-part)))




This bug report was last modified 8 years and 320 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.